I have some basic questions that I am hoping this forum can answer. I would like to purchase 5S3P Li-Ion battery with a BMS/balancer. I have multiple applications: A) 5S3P (x3) in series for an equivalent 15S3P configuration B) 5S3P (x3) in parallel for a 5S9P configuration.....I am trying to decide whether to do a 15S BMS that is over-sized both on the voltage and current to support the requirements of the parallel configuration OR whether to embed each 5S3P as suggested with a 5S BMS. So now to my questions:
1. If I purchase the 5S3P with BMS/balancer and three in parallel of these packs in parallel to get the capacity, will the BMS/balancers in each conflict with each other? My understanding is parallel cells balance themselves out and the BMS is there to support the series cells, so my inclination is to think that the three in parallel will work??
2. If I go with a 15S BMS/balancer can I hook (3x) 5S3P (only cells here no BMS on the 5S3P's) at the bottom end of the 15S BMS and will it work (assuming of course it has been chosen to support the 9 parallel cells current charging / discharging requirements?
3. Final question, very similar to Question 2...Would I be able to build the battery packs up WITHOUT BMS and then use a single 5S BMS/balancer external to the packs to balance 5S3P (x3) in parallel if I sized it appropriately for the current for the 9 parallel cells?
